Well refurbished old stone barn with loads of character set in the countryside. Enjoyed sitting in the courtyard in the glorious sunshine whilst the dog ran around the yard. Then relaxing in the evening in front of the wood stove. We all said it was a shame we couldn't have explored the local area more - due to the English weather and sodden ground (that we have been experiencing up and down the cpuntry) and family focus. We would like to come back during warmer dryer weather. The cottage is next door to the owner's house and we were warmly greeted. Enter at ground level to the kitchen/dining area with a stone floor - with all necessary appliances (incl dishwasher - a must on holiday). Then up a flight of stone stairs with wrought iron railing to the open plan living area where there is loads of space with 2 huge comfy sofas, large coffee table, TV and wood stove (and reading materials). Up a couple of steps to the main bedroom tastefully decorated and well laid out with amenities behind the bed head wall. (shower unit on one side with vanity and toilet and another vanity on the other). An unusual but very lush bonus was a very deep bath in the main bedroom. Brilliant for a relaxing soak after a long day. Off to the other side was a twin bedroom with its own ensuite toilet and shower. Really handy to have two ensuite bathrooms (but remember your own hand soap). The upstairs was well heated, no shortage of hot water and a good supply of firewood. We recommend the High farm shop nearby for supplies and easy access to nearby Ashover supermarkets and stores. Close to the Peak District walls. The cottage is on a hill with lovely outlooks but quite a steep walk or run so be prepared. Very welcoming to our children and dog. Pet's pyjamas sorted us out a treat and the owners were very friendly and helpful. Highly recommended! Oh and great WiFi and signal ☺️
